First off, what do we mean when we say “absolute value”? It sounds fancy, but it’s pretty straightforward. The absolute value of a number is its distance from zero on the number line, regardless of direction. This means you’re always dealing with a non-negative number. Take the expression |x|, where x can be any number—think of that as a ‘magnitude’ sign.

Now, let’s put this into practice with a common type of question you might encounter. Consider the following options and determine which holds the greatest value:

  • A. |−11|
  • B. −11
  • C. 1/11
  • D. −1/11

At first glance, it can be tempting to just throw out the negatives as candidates for the largest value, but it’s crucial we look at each option through the lens of absolute value. Here’s a breakdown:

  1. Option A: |−11| = 11
  2. Option B: -11 = −11
  3. Option C: 1/11 = approximately 0.0909
  4. Option D: −1/11 = −0.0909

When we evaluate these figures, it becomes pretty evident that |−11|, which equals 11, is the largest value. This means that option A shines as the front-runner in our little competition! The negative values, -11 and -1/11, drag us down because, well, negativity isn’t so great in this scenario (or usually!). Even 1/11, while positive, simply cannot compete with the magnitude of 11.
